Mathematically, the speedof sound is computeddividing thedistance travelledby thepulse by the timespent to travel it (timeof flight), asdisclosed inEq. (5). υ¼2 �Δs t (5) Here, Δs is the distance separating the ultrasonic surface and the reflecting interface (the travelling distance is twice this value) and t is the time required for the ultrasonic pulse to transpose thatdistanceandreturnto the transducer.Thisprocesscanberepeatedmanytimes, dependingon theattenuationand thedistance fromthe transducerand the reflecting surface. After each subsequent reflection, the pulse amplitude will decrease, as a consequence of attenuation. The multiple reflections will remain until the sound energy is completely absorbed in theprocess.Figure2exhibits thatmulti-reflectionbehaviour. Whileplanning the experimental set-up for thepulse/echomethod, onemust be aware about theabsorptionof the liquidunder investigation,aswellas thedistancebetweenthetransducer and the reflecting surface. The pulse frequency plays a key role, as ultrasonic attenuation is exponentially proportional to the frequency. In general, water is used as reference once its behaviourboth forattenuationandultrasonicvelocityareverywellknown[26–29]. Figure2. Ultrasonicpulseandreflections.
